Tretinoin peels is what happens two to three days after your skin has been exposed to a hefty dose of an irritating retinoid like tret or retinol. Hydroxypinacolone Retinoate is what they call an ester of all trans retinoid acid, which means that it has a very similar shape to the tretinoin molecule and can therefore link with all the retinoid receptors that tretinoin can without any conversion steps. In the skin (and in other places too) there are vitamin A receptors, called Retinoid Acid Receptors or RARs.
